ClioSport Club Member
  Clio 182
No pic update today. Started to get the sump off. Removed the top engine mount, dog bone and box mount and jacked the engine up as far as it would go. Got all the accessible bolts out bar one which drilled out pretty easily. I need a E8 on a 1/4 drive as my 3/8 was too fat for the holes on the box side so that stopped play. In the meantime I’ve clocked the turbo again slightly to get a bit more space for the coolant lines and the actuator now sits slightly further away from the bulkhead. The downpipe is still very very close to the pas setup but there’s not really anything else I can do about that given the hot side is fixed in place in relation to the manifold. Just gonna have to heat wrap it to death and hope for the best. Last bit was a lick of paint on the rocker cover and some paint on the inlet manifold. Was going to go the Rover grey that pretty much matches the wheels but the wife liked the colour of the yellowish filler primer so may end up going something along those lines instead. I’d half hoped to make it look almost factory in the bay but given she’s not complaining I’ll probably go yellow 😂. More on Wednesday when I’ve got a half day

Yarp

ClioSport Club Member
  Clio 182
Finally managed to find an oil feed for the china special corona turbo. Bought basically 1 of everything I could find in a 1/4” thread and one of the 6 in the packet worked. Handily as they weren’t labelled I’ve got no idea which one it was. T is m14 in/out for the oil sensor with a 1/8”npt to 4an for the oil hose. That then goes to a 4an to some random 1/4” thing at the turbo end. The hose length actually makes for quite a neat routing and fitment

Thanks, I must admit I’m having fun just picking away at it bit by bit.

I forgot to share the oil return the other day. I’ve tapped it into the sump. I know a lot of people say to use that flat bit on the block but given the engine is in situ that wasn’t a feasible option. Tapping a sump on a bench is a much easier job. You can see the oily tide mark on the old sump where the oil level sits so the rerun sits miles above that. I’ve also finally sourced the illusive phase 1 fuel rail and regulator. It’s coming with fuel lines too but I don’t really like them running behind the turbo so will probably stick with my original plan and make my own running down the box side and under
